I have just recently purchased a 1992 Coupe, Canadian Version and am learning as I go along which is fun and of course frustrating at times. My problem that I am asking about today is that when I lock the car with my key, the door, luggage compartment and fuel cap lid all lock, but then the fuel cap lid pin retracts ever so slightly so as to not go in the hole so that it locks. I have sprayed some WD40 on it, which to me would not help as it does extend fully, but as I said retracts, but thought may as well give it a try. I have checked with the lid open as I thought it may be hitting the piece that it should be sliding into, but that is not the case as it still retracts. Any ideas?
